Essential Ingredients

Here’s what you’ll need to make this delicious dish:

  • Frozen Hash Browns: Opt for the shredded variety for maximum crispiness and ease of preparation.

  • Eggs: Fresh eggs are essential; go for large ones for optimal yolk perfection.

  • Bacon: Choose thick-cut bacon for richer flavor and satisfying crunch.

  • All-Purpose Flour: This will help thicken your gravy; no need for fancy flour here!

  • Milk: Whole milk adds creaminess to your gravy; don’t skimp on richness.

  • Chicken Broth: Use low-sodium broth to control saltiness while adding depth of flavor.

  • Salt and Pepper: Essential for seasoning; always adjust according to your taste preferences.

  • Garlic Powder: A sprinkle adds fantastic flavor without any chopping fuss.

  • Onion Powder: This gives your gravy an aromatic base without the tears!

  • Hot Sauce (optional): For those who like a little kick in their breakfast.

How to Make Egg Topped Hash Browns with Bacon Gravy

Crispy Hash Browns Preparation: Start by heating a non-stick skillet over medium heat and adding some oil. Once hot, spread your frozen hash browns evenly in the pan and cook until they are golden brown and crispy on both sides. Flip them carefully using a spatula to keep them intact.

Bacon Gravy Creation: In another pan, cook chopped bacon over medium heat until crispy. Remove the bacon but leave the drippings—this is where magic happens! Stir in flour into drippings until combined and bubbly, then slowly whisk in milk and chicken broth until smooth.

Add Seasonings: Season your gravy mixture with salt, pepper, garlic powder, and onion powder. Continue stirring until it thickens slightly—about 3-5 minutes should do it! If you’re feeling adventurous, add hot sauce at this stage for some extra zing.

Egg Cooking: While the gravy simmers away happily, crack eggs into a separate pan (or use the same one if you’re feeling bold). Cook them sunny-side-up until whites are set and yolks remain runny—this takes about 3-4 minutes.

Piling It All Together: Time to assemble! Place crispy hash browns on plates or bowls, top generously with bacon gravy followed by those glistening eggs. Sprinkle some extra bacon bits on top if you want to impress!

Storing & Reheating

Store leftovers in an airtight container in the fridge for up to three days. Reheat hash browns in a skillet for optimal crispiness and warm the gravy separately.

Chef's Helpful Tips

  • Perfect crispy hash browns require high heat; don’t overcrowd the pan, or they’ll steam instead of fry
  • Always taste your gravy before serving; adjusting seasoning can make a significant difference
  • Use fresh eggs for poaching; they hold their shape better and look beautiful on top

FAQ

Can I make this dish vegetarian?

You can easily substitute bacon with mushrooms or smoked tempeh for flavor.

What type of potatoes are best for hash browns?

Russet potatoes are ideal due to their high starch content and crispy texture.

How do I prevent my hash browns from sticking?

Make sure your pan is well-oiled and preheated before adding the potatoes for cooking.

Ingredients

Scale
  • 4 cups frozen shredded hash browns
  • 4 large eggs
  • 6 slices thick-cut bacon
  • 1/4 cup all-purpose flour
  • 1 cup whole milk
  • 1 cup low-sodium chicken broth
  • 1/2 tsp salt (adjust to taste)
  • 1/2 tsp black pepper (adjust to taste)
  • 1/2 tsp garlic powder
  • 1/2 tsp onion powder
  • Hot sauce to taste (optional)

Instructions

  1. Heat a non-stick skillet over medium heat and add oil. Spread the frozen hash browns evenly and cook until golden brown and crispy, about 5-7 minutes per side.
  2. In another pan, cook chopped bacon over medium heat until crispy. Remove the bacon, leaving drippings in the pan.
  3. Stir flour into the drippings until combined; slowly whisk in milk and chicken broth until smooth. Season with salt, pepper, garlic powder, and onion powder. Cook for 3-5 minutes until thickened.
  4. In a separate pan, cook eggs sunny-side-up for about 3-4 minutes.
  5. Serve crispy hash browns topped with bacon gravy and eggs. Optional: add extra bacon bits on top.
